bulbousness
Noun
/ˈbʌl.bəs.nəs/

Definition
The quality of being bulbous or rounded in shape, resembling a bulb.

Examples
- The bulbousness of the plant made it easy to identify.
- Many fish exhibit bulbousness in their bodies, which can aid in buoyancy.

Meaning
Bulbousness refers to a state or characteristic of something that has a swollen or rounded form, similar to that of a bulb.

Synonyms
- Roundness
- Swollenness
- Globularity
